There are 3 different kinds of mental health treatment, including residential, outpatient, and hospital inpatient. Some individuals who need help for a mental issue may desire an outpatient option because of their responsibilities or due to the possible tarnishing of their reputation associated with their issue. Many clients can still have a normal work or school day and get outpatient mental health treatment with 100% privacy and discretion.
Outpatient mental health facilities are either based in community health centers, private offices, or hospitals in Needles. The intensity of outpatient mental health treatment can vary from facility to facility, but can be from participation a few days a week to daily treatment. An outpatient mental health facility will first do a full assessment of the client's medical history, both physical and mental, which includes their prescription drug and illicit drug history. Psychological evaluation is also an usual process, and clinicians and doctors will design a plan of treatment that can include individual psychotherapy, group therapy, family therapy, marriage/couples counseling, etc. If the individual requiring treatment also has a co-occurring disorder such as a drug addiction, most outpatient mental health facilities are ready to treat this dual diagnosis.
